Peter Docteroff

Loved the happy hour here. Not a ton of drink options, but prices on beer and wine were reasonable. We ordered the mussels, brussels, and beet salad. The beet salad was for sure the highlight- tasty beets at the bottom of the plate topped with arugula and fried goat cheese balls. Mussels and brussels were also very tasty. Prices were fairly reasonable across a large variety of appetizers.

Martha L

What a great addition to the East Boulder food scene with plenty of parking and a stunning view across the golf course to the Flatirons, the new Ironwood Cafe was a pleasant surprise. They offer a diverse happy hour that meant the two of us could try a variety of food, each enjoy a cocktail, and share a dessert for less than $70. The food was very good and the service was attractive and friendly.
